In the automotive and truck industry, the term "vacuum 22.5 rims" refers primarily to a specific type of wheel designed for heavy-duty vehicles, particularly in the commercial trucking sector. Understanding the intricacies of these rims is crucial for professionals who deal with drive systems, as they play a pivotal role in vehicle performance, safety, and efficiency.
Vacuum 22.5 rims are characterized by their size—22.5 inches in diameter—and their unique construction. Unlike traditional rims that may rely on standard mounting techniques, vacuum rims utilize a specialized sealing process to enhance air retention and minimize weight. This construction method not only reduces the risk of leaks but also allows for greater performance in terms of handling and fuel efficiency. The design is particularly beneficial for long-haul trucks, where maintaining optimal tire pressure is essential for fuel savings and tire longevity.
One of the significant advantages of vacuum 22.5 rims is their compatibility with wide-base tires, which further enhances the vehicle's aerodynamics and traction. The wider tire contact patch improves road grip, especially in challenging conditions, providing drivers with better control and stability. This is invaluable in commercial applications where safety and reliability are paramount.
Moreover, professionals should be aware of the maintenance considerations specific to vacuum 22.5 rims. Regular inspections are essential to ensure that seals remain intact and that the rims are free from corrosion or damage. Proper maintenance not only extends the life of the rims but also contributes to overall vehicle performance. When performing routine checks, it's advisable to monitor the tire pressure regularly, as even a small drop can lead to significant performance issues over time.
In terms of installation, vacuum 22.5 rims require specific tools and techniques to ensure proper fitting and sealing. It is recommended that technicians are trained in the installation process to avoid common pitfalls that could compromise the rim's integrity. Additionally, using compatible tires and following manufacturer guidelines is critical to achieving optimal performance.
In conclusion, vacuum 22.5 rims present a specialized solution for heavy-duty vehicles in the automotive industry. Their unique construction and design contribute significantly to performance, fuel efficiency, and safety. Understanding these aspects is vital for professionals in the field, ensuring they can provide the best service and advice to their clients. Regular maintenance and proper installation techniques will further enhance the benefits of these rims, making them an essential consideration in the drive system segment of the automotive market.
